Toshiba Brave Lupus Tokyo face off against Hanazono Kintetsu Liners in Japan Rugby League One Round 6 on Fri 27th January 2023 at Prince Chichibu Memorial Stadium. Kick-off in the UK is scheduled for 03:00. In South Africa it’s at 05:00 SAST, 16:00 NZST in New Zealand, 14:00 AEST in Australia and 19:00 EST in the US.
Toshiba Brave Lupus Tokyo won the last encounter but Toshiba Brave Lupus Tokyo are in the best form of their last 5 games.
Heading into the fixture the two sides are separated by just 4 places in the league table with Hanazono Kintetsu Liners in 2nd and Toshiba Brave Lupus Tokyo in 6th underlining just how tight this match could be.
